    1 Star - We Came for Dinner... We Left With a Story…read more My girlfriend, my mom, and I came to Dale's Restaurant in Southaven expecting a nice dinner. What we got instead was an unexpected exercise in patience. When we sat down, the place wasn't very busy, so we figured service would move along pretty smoothly. Unfortunately, our table seemed to be skipped multiple times. It felt like we accidentally sat at the "invisible guest" table because staff kept walking past us and forgetting what they were supposed to bring. While waiting, they brought us sweet tea and cornbread muffins. Now listen... I like sweet tea as much as the next Southerner, but this one was so sweet it felt like it skipped tea entirely and went straight to syrup. If hummingbirds ever open a restaurant, this would probably be their house drink. The cornbread muffins were an adventure of their own. They were very dry, spongy, and unusually sweet -- almost like someone confused cornbread with dessert. Imagine expecting cornbread and getting something closer to candy. That's the closest description I can give. The atmosphere didn't help the situation either. The vents above the dining area looked like they hadn't been cleaned in a while, the walls felt bland and lifeless, and several tablecloths were torn. Along the bottom trim where the wall meets the floor, it looked like there was some serious wear and possible moisture damage going on. After waiting long enough and tasting what we had, we decided to call it. I spoke with the manager, who did apologize and told us not to worry about the bill, which I appreciated. That was probably the best part of the visit. At that point we decided to leave and find dinner somewhere else. Nick's Final Bite: We came for dinner... but left with sweet tea syrup and a cornbread identity crisis.

    I haven't done a review for Huey's in quite some time. I figured it was time for an update. I…read moreconsider Huey's in Southaven "Old Faithful. I have never really gotten anything bad at Huey's ad the service is always good. I absolutely love their spinach and artichoke. Dip. I also love their soups. My wife and I stopped in before a show. I started out with the soup of the day. It was a white bean with chicken and chili. I know that don't sound great....lol...But let me tell you that was a very good soup. It had a very unique flavor. My wife got her usual steak on a stick. She said it was very tender and flavorful. She also got a order of The Onion rings. If you like the big onion rings, you can't go wrong. I got the Reuben sandwich and onion straws. It was hands down one of the best Reuben's I've had in quite some time. I highly recommend Southaven Huey's. if you want a good meal for a good price you can't go wrong here. Oh, and be sure to try the soup of the day you won't be disappointed. The inside is always very nice and clean. They have lived music occasionally and a full bar. It's just an all around fun place to go in my opinion.
